Cooling

The DSC 6000 incorporates a built-in cooling chamber that lies below and is attached to the
furnace assembly. The chamber uses a simple in/out design which allows for the use of any
noncorrosive circulating liquid or cooling gas.
For cooling with liquids, many commercial circulating coolers are available that can be
interfaced to the DSC 6000. The Polyscience Chiller (P/N N5370220/N5370221, 120 V and
220 V, respectively) is the recommended cooling device for the range –20 °C to 445 °C. The
Intracooler (P/N N5374098/N5374099) is recommended for the range –65 °C to 445 °C. The
Portable Cooling Device (P/N N5202068) can also be used to quickly cool the DSC 6000 to
ambient temperature, or to cool below room temperature for occasional subambient
measurements. It can be filled with ice, ice water, liquid nitrogen or any other cooling
mixtures.
The DSC 6000 with CryoFill uses liquid nitrogen for operation in the range of –170 °C to
300 °C. The pressure-controlled liquid nitrogen dewar system delivers LN2 to a built-in dewar
in the measuring cell at a rate of 2.5 l/hr.
